Kandovan (Persian: كندوان, also romanized as Kandovān and Kandavān; also known as Kanvān) is an ancient village in Sahand Rural District in the Central District of Osku County, East Azerbaijan Province, northwestern Iran.It is situated in the foothills of Mount Sahand, near the city of Osku.At the 2006 census, the village population was 601, in 168 families. Kandovan is placed 18 km south of Osko, at the bottom of a green mountain called Soltandaghi.What has given Kandovan a historic identity is a large amount of cone shaped stones where people have made houses, workshops, stables, and storage. It exhibits an exceptional rock-cut architecture and life style.
